Chagara Textiles
Chagara is a block-printing workshop in Egypt that specializes in authentic fabrics, combining self-expression and story inspired textiles.
Our Creative aim is to introduce motifs that represent our modern world. To reach this, we considered the motif our theatre, in which a square is a character that performs an act. This act is part of a story or the play that we write, but instead of following the traditional stories, we take matters in our hands and create new stories that abstract our everyday experience in life.
Design and Expression
The design process is inspired by self-expression and story narration. It combines traditional crafts with modern design approaches to bring about collaboration between designers of all sorts closer to merge their designing skills with unique textiles into everyday products. This is also inspired by the primitive communities where work is linked to life and production is linked to a real need of expressing oneself through products.
